What is Exterior Paint That Looks Like Stucco and How Does It Work?

Exterior paint that looks like stucco is a paint that is formulated to mimic the textured appearance of stucco. This type of paint contains additives that create a rough and grainy finish that resembles the look and feel of stucco. The paint is applied in multiple layers, with each layer adding to the textured appearance. The final result is a finish that looks just like stucco, but without the high cost and maintenance requirements.

The Benefits of Exterior Paint That Looks Like Stucco

There are several benefits to choosing exterior paint that looks like stucco for your home’s exterior. These include:

Cost-Effective

Exterior paint that looks like stucco is a cost-effective alternative to traditional stucco. It is much cheaper to purchase and apply, making it a great option for homeowners on a budget.

Low Maintenance

Unlike traditional stucco, exterior paint that looks like stucco requires very little maintenance. It is easy to clean and does not require any special treatments or sealants.

Customizable

Exterior paint that looks like stucco comes in a wide range of colors, allowing you to customize the look of your home’s exterior to fit your personal style and preferences.

How to Apply Exterior Paint That Looks Like Stucco

Applying exterior paint that looks like stucco is a straightforward process that can be completed by most homeowners. Here are the steps involved: 1. Clean the surface of your home’s exterior to remove any dirt or debris. 2. Apply a coat of primer to the surface to ensure that the paint adheres properly. 3. Apply the first layer of paint using a roller or paint sprayer. 4. Allow the first layer to dry completely before applying the second layer. 5. Apply the second layer using the same method as the first. 6. Repeat the process until you have achieved the desired texture and finish.
